Fabio Alexandre da Silva Coentrao is a Portuguese footballer who plays for Real Madrid in Spain, and the Portuguese national team. Mainly a left back, he can also operate as a left winger, and occasionally as a central midfielder. Real Madrid On 5 July 2011, after extensive negotiations, Benfica and Real Madrid reached an agreement in principle over the transfer of Coentrao, who signed a six-year contract the same day, for 30m. Central defender Ezequiel Garay went in the other direction as part of the deal. Coentrao made his Real Madrid debut in a pre-season friendly against L.A. Galaxy on 16 July 2011, creating an assist for Karim Benzema and also receiving Man of the match honours. His first two official games were against FC Barcelona for the season's Spanish Supercup: in the first leg, he replaced Sami Khedira in the second half of a 2-2 home draw and played as a central midfielder, and he started as left-back in the second match, a 2-3 loss at the Camp Nou. Coentrao made his La Liga debut on 28 August 2011 against former club Zaragoza, appearing as a central midfielder in a 6-0 away win (90 minutes played). While he played mostly in these positions, he was also deployed by manager Jose Mourinho as a right defender, against Sporting de Gijon on 3 December and against Barcelona the following week. Fabio Coentrao is one of the best left backs in the current football scene thanks to his solid game in attack, excellent dribbling skills, powerful shot and varsatility, which allows him to play anywhere down the wings. He is very experienced despite his young age. The first important team he played for was Rio Ave, with whom he made his First Division debut when he was just 16. His excellent performances caught Benfica's attention, who decided to sign him in 2007 and loaned him out to Nacional, notching 16 appearances and 4 goals. Coentrao returned to Rio Ave after a brief spell with Spanish side Zaragoza. His good run in the 2008/09 campaign secured his return to Benfica, with whom he truly blossomed and won his first titles, such as the 2009/10 edition of the league and the 2010/11 Cup of Portugal. Coentrao first played for his country on the youth national teams, making his first team debut in 2009 against Bosnia-Herzegovina.
Tan Sri Anthony Francis Fernandes CBE (also known as Tony Fernandes) is a Malaysian entrepreneur. He is the founder of Tune Air Sdn. Bhd., who introduced the first budget no-frills airline, Air Asia, to Malaysians with the tagline "Now everyone can fly". He has since founded the Tune Group of companies. Fernandes was born in Kuala Lumpur to a Goan (Indian) father, and Kristang mother, Ena Dorothy Fernandes. He was educated at Epsom College between 1977 and 1983 and graduated from the London School of Economics in 1987. He worked very briefly with Virgin Atlantic as an auditor, subsequently becoming the financial controller for Richard Branson's Virgin Records in London from 1987 to 1989. Fernandes is the founder of the Caterham F1 Formula One team, which began racing in 2010 as Lotus Racing and raced in 2011 as Team Lotus. In December 2009, Fernandes accepted a "challenge" from Richard Branson, a fellow airline boss and the owner of Lotus' fellow F1 newcomers Virgin Racing. The losing team's boss would work on the winner's airline for a day dressed as a stewardess. Fernandes joked "the sexier the better'. Branson lost but has not carried out the forfeit yet Feranndes is a West Ham fan and revealed in 2011 that he intended to buy shares in the club however West Ham owners David Gold and David Sullivan rejected his offer and he turned his attention to Queens Park Rangers. Fernandes was unveiled as the majority shareholder of QPR in May 2011, having bought Bernie Ecclestone's 66% share. He was also named as chairman of QPR Holdings Ltd. Fernandes has bought several high profile players as well as manager Harry Redknapp to QPR. These include Joey Barton, Djibril Cisse, Julio Cesar, Bobby Zamora, Shaun Wright Phillips and Park Ji Sung.

Ross Turnbull is an English footballer who plays for Chelsea as a goalkeeper. Chelsea On 2 July 2009, Turnbull joined Chelsea on a free transfer, signing a four-year contract. Turnbull announced that he would not sit by as a permanent second place keeper to regular starting goalkeeper Petr Cech and that he would fight for his own first team place. His first involvement in the first team was after being named on the bench for Chelsea's first game of the 2009-10 season against Hull City at Stamford Bridge, which finished 2-1 in favour of Chelsea. Turnbull had a Chelsea reserves debut to forget when he made a series of blunders as the team lost 4-0 to Aston Villa. He made his first team debut against Bolton Wanderers in the League Cup, coming on for the injured Henrique Hilario after 23 minutes, a game which Chelsea won 4-0. He made his first start in the UEFA Champions League 2-2 draw against APOEL. He made his Premier League debut against West Ham United in a 4-1 win as Petr Cech and Henrique Hilario respectively were both injured. The following Tuesday, he started for Chelsea against Inter Milan at Stamford Bridge, in which he conceded a goal with Inter winning 1-0 but otherwise had a decent performance. He made another Premier League appearance against Blackburn Rovers in a 1-1 draw on 21 March 2010. He was not part of the matchday squad who defeated Portsmouth in the 2010 FA Cup Final, but still received a winner's medal. He did not play enough games that season to earn a Premier League medal. Turnbull made his first appearance of the 2010/2011 season when he played in the League Cup third round against Newcastle United as Chelsea went on to lose 4-3. On 23 November 2010, Turnbull made another appearance in the Champions League Matchday 5 group stage against Slovakian side MsK Zilina as Chelsea won 2-1 when they came from a goal down to beat them. For the most part of the season, Turnbull remained second choice keeper behind Cech. In the 2011/12 season, Turnbull began to get some more playing time. His first appearance of the 2011/12 season came he played in the League Cup third round against Fulham. The game finished 0-0 after extra time, and Chelsea subsequently beat Fulham 4-3 on penalties to go through to the next round. During normal time, Turnbull saved a penalty from Pajtim Kasami after Alex gave away the penalty (which resulted in a red card for Alex). In the penalty shootout, Turnbull saved 2 penalties from Moussa Dembele and Bryan Ruiz. His next appearance in the League Cup was in the last 16 match against Everton. With 58 minutes gone, he conceded a penalty and received a red card. Cech took his place after coming on for Romelu Lukaku and saved the penalty from Leighton Baines. Chelsea went on to beat Everton 2-1 and go through to the next round. A quarter final appearance followed, and was to be his, and Chelsea's, last in the League Cup as they lost 2-0 to Liverpool. During the match, Turnbull saved a penalty from Andy Carroll, given away once again by Alex. With the 2011-12 Premier League season almost over, Turnbull played the final two league games against Liverpool (lost 4-1) and Blackburn (won 2-1) as Cech was rested prior to the Champions League Final, in which Turnbull picked up a medal as an unused substitute. The game against Liverpool was his first league match in 2 years. His poor clearance led directly to a goal from Jonjo Shelvey.

Thanos was created in the comics by Jim Starlin in 1973. He was born on
Titan, Saturn’s moon, and is one of the most powerful and dangerous
beings in the Marvel Universe. The villain is passionate about the
personification of Death, and seeks extermination.
Several times he came close of destroying the universe, being stopped
only by the union of several Marvel heroes. He is in the the constant
search of the Infinity Stones, gems with different powers. Forging the
Infinity Gauntlet, an artifact that will give you the power of a God.
Thanos is the main antagonist in Avengers: Endgame.
